Two inventors, from Kitchener, Ontario, Canada, thought there needed to be an easy way to improve putting and golf scores, so they invented the patent-pending ULTIMATE PUTTER.

The ULTIMATE PUTTER enables a golfer to putt with better alignment, aim and follow-through. In doing so, it eliminates the need to stoop or crouch to align the ball with the cup. As a result, it enhances comfort and confidence on the green and it could help to improve a golfer’s technique and short game.
